On Nov 24, 3:50 pm, Nigel Kersten <[email protected]> wrote: > I mentioned this in an earlier thread, but here's a dedicated one. > > We made a big change between 0.24.x and 0.25.x where we moved from > XMLRPC to REST. > > How do people feel about us dropping all XMLRPC support from 2.7.x, > such that it only supported Puppet clients 0.25.x and higher?
+1 to dropping .24 and 2.7 interoperability. I don't recall running mismatched client/server ever being a suggested setup. How many sites out there are actually running .24 with 2.6, or even .25, as a stable setup? People seem to be conflating legacy support with interversion compatibility.
